WebFeb 7, 2024 · Angelfish eggs look like your regular fish eggs. When first laid, the adhesive eggs sport an off-white color. And once the male fertilizes them, the eggs will develop a translucent amber to brownish hues. If the eggs turn stark white, it means they have met their fate – they weren’t fertilized.
